Early in-person voting began Wednesday for city and school elections

By: Matt Scher, matts@977thebolt.com

Dakota City, IA – Early in-person voting began Wednesday for this year’s city and school elections.

In Humboldt County, the in-person absentee voting is taking place inside the Humboldt County Auditor’s Office within the courthouse in Dakota City. Mailed out ballots began to be sent that day to those who have requested them.

Upcoming important dates for this year’s election include the deadline to request an absentee mailed out ballot being Monday, October 20.  The deadline for voter-preregistration, which requires less documentation, is also on Oct. 20.

Election day this year is Nov 4.
